On April 22, the General Office of the People's Government of Guangdong Province issued the Action Plan for Accelerating the High-level All-domain, All-time and All-industry Application of Artificial Intelligence in Guangdong Province (hereinafter referred to as the Action Plan). The plan aims to accelerate the development of new quality productive forces, foster and expand new driving forces, and build a national highland for integrated AI application.
The Action Plan further integrates the "AI +" model into health, medical care, pharmaceuticals and other related fields. It makes overall arrangements in key directions including scientific research, emerging industries and people’s well-being, driving artificial intelligence to empower all industries and benefit every household. The key contents are specified as follows:
Develop novel brain-inspired algorithms, carry out research on brain-inspired computing architectures and neuromorphic chips, and build low-power, high-performance general brain-inspired intelligent computing systems. Promote the integration of cutting-edge AI technologies such as brain-computer interface and embodied intelligence, and support the R&D of peripheral equipment including brain-controlled rehabilitation humanoid robots, exoskeletons, robotic arms and prosthetic limbs.
Advance digital transformation in production links, AI visual quality inspection and optimization of green manufacturing processes, improve the quality of competitive products such as condiments, beverages and Cantonese mooncakes, and drive the intelligent upgrading of industries including bakery foods and preserved fruits. Support food enterprises in introducing AI-based intelligent detection and sorting equipment, promote intelligent upgrading of food production links, reduce labor costs, and cultivate enterprises featured with integrated application of AI plus food industry.
Promote in-depth integration of artificial intelligence and food safety supervision, build a full-chain traceability system, and comprehensively enhance capabilities in food risk monitoring, traceability, early warning and prediction.
Adopt generative AI, deep learning and other technologies to carry out research on new drug design and screening, recombinant antibody synthesis, drug delivery systems, optimize pharmaceutical R&D processes and shorten R&D cycles. Promote AI-enabled inheritance and innovation of traditional Chinese medicine, and conduct real-world data research on TCM.
Support the intelligent upgrading of medical devices, focus on R&D and registration of innovative formats such as medical robots and digital therapeutics, and accelerate the application of intelligent rehabilitation assistive devices and elderly-friendly care equipment.
Apply AI technologies in all links of clinical trials to improve trial efficiency, support the implementation of smart diagnosis and treatment as well as auxiliary clinical decision-making, and accelerate the clinical evaluation of special approved drugs and medical devices. Build a smart supervision platform for drug and device safety via artificial intelligence, strengthen full-process supervision, and ensure traceable product safety.
Promote the industrial application of synthetic biotechnology, focus on cutting-edge technologies such as precise gene editing, artificially synthesized cells and cell factories, build AI-enabled innovation platforms for biomanufacturing, and advance the construction of major innovation platforms including China Digital Lung and the Guangdong-Hong Kong-Macao Greater Bay Area Bioinformatics Center.
Optimize biomanufacturing processes with artificial intelligence, accelerate the breeding of cells and strains, improve production efficiency and reduce manufacturing costs. Promote the large-scale application of synthetic biotechnology in pharmaceuticals, chemical industry, agriculture and other fields, expand the industrial scale of bio-based materials and future food, and drive high-quality development of the biomanufacturing industry.
Promote digital and intelligent upgrading and expansion of housekeeping services, and improve the AI application capabilities of housekeeping practitioners. Support housekeeping service enterprises to provide precise services with AI technologies, and expand consumption scenarios of housekeeping services relying on robots and other new technologies and equipment.
Carry out joint research and application tackling focusing on scenarios such as care for the disabled and demented people, health promotion and daily life assistance, promote the application of embodied intelligent robots in home-based elderly care and community care scenarios, and encourage the development of emotional companion intelligent assistants.
Advance the construction and application of "Internet + AI Supervision" in the food sector. Adopt machine vision and other technologies to carry out off-site intelligent supervision on key links including food production and processing, circulation and storage, and catering services, realizing automatic identification and interception of problematic products as well as real-time early warning of potential risks.
Gradually promote the construction of a vertical large model for food safety in phases, deeply integrate multi-source data including sampling inspection, complaint reporting and public opinion monitoring, develop practical tools for intelligent judgment of food safety risks and intelligent identification of false publicity, and enhance the foresight and accuracy of risk discovery and disposal.
Deepen data connection and algorithm co-governance with e-commerce and food delivery platforms, and conduct dynamic monitoring and intelligent early warning of irregularities for online food sales.
Steadily promote the innovative application of artificial intelligence in the full life-cycle supervision of drugs (including medical devices and cosmetics, the same below), improve the efficiency and quality of drug supervision, forge a new pattern of smart governance for drug safety, and provide strong support for deepening drug supervision reform and ensuring public medication safety.
Focus on building a human-machine collaborative intelligent review and approval system, enhance the digital and intelligent supervision capacity of the whole chain covering drug research, production and circulation, promote the digital upgrading of risk supervision systems, advance the intelligence and standardization of inspection and law enforcement, and strengthen cross-regional, cross-level and cross-departmental collaborative supervision capabilities.
Consolidate the basic support system of "AI + Drug Supervision", build high-quality data sets, vertical large models and intelligent agents that meet the needs of intelligent supervision, and improve the mechanisms for security protection and operational management.
Promote the in-depth full-process application of artificial intelligence in health fields including disease prevention, precision diagnosis, intelligent treatment, health management, medical insurance services and public health prevention and control. Popularize the application of tools such as the Guangdong Medical Intelligent Imaging System, Guangdong Medical Intelligent Auxiliary Diagnosis System, intelligent follow-up and intelligent monitoring and early warning of infectious diseases.
Accelerate the popularization of intelligent equipment and facilities in medical institutions, enhance the capacity for early screening, early diagnosis and early treatment of major diseases, and raise the smart service level of hospitals. Promote the sinking of high-quality medical resources and intelligent technologies to grassroots levels, strengthen the application of remote consultation and intelligent auxiliary diagnosis and treatment, and facilitate the implementation of hierarchical medical treatment.
Improve the full-life-cycle intelligent health services for residents, promote the in-depth integration of artificial intelligence with medical treatment, services and management in TCM hospitals, explore innovation and application in TCM electronic medical records, TCM health management, inheritance of renowned veteran TCM doctors, and smart TCM pharmacies. Build a number of application scenarios with TCM characteristics, and drive the digital and intelligent development of TCM hospitals.
Deepen the full-scenario application of artificial intelligence in the elderly care sector, build integrated smart solutions for scenarios such as home-based elderly care beds, smart nursing homes and community elderly care service stations. Enrich the supply of smart elderly care products and services, and improve a smart elderly care service system coordinating home, community and institutional care and integrating medical treatment with health preservation and elderly care.
Support enterprises in researching and developing elderly-friendly products such as smart wearable devices, rehabilitation aids, intelligent care equipment and safety monitoring terminals. Popularize intelligent terminals integrating one-click call, intelligent monitoring and emotional interaction, continuously improve the intelligence level of elderly care services, and foster new driving forces for the silver economy.
Accelerate the construction of smart nursery services, optimize core services such as infant and child care, early development, safety monitoring and nutritional health relying on artificial intelligence, and promote application scenarios including intelligent morning check-up, growth and development monitoring and dietary nutrition recommendation. Improve the standardization and refined management level of nursery institutions.
Optimize the construction of smart nursery information systems, integrate multi-domain data including birth records, child health care and medical treatment, connect the full-chain services covering infant birth and nursery care, and realize perceptible, visible and traceable whole-process nursery services. Improve the full-cycle quality of nursery services, build an intelligent nursery ecosystem covering health management, teaching and nursing assistance, and home-kindergarten collaboration, and boost the quality improvement and capacity expansion of inclusive nursery services.
